The blockchain arena is dominated by two major platforms for decentralized applications: Ethereum and Cardano. Both support smart contracts and NFTs, but they take fundamentally different approaches to technology, cost, and scalability. This comparison dives into the core differences to help you determine which platform is better suited for your specific needs in the world of decentralized finance and digital assets.
Understanding the Core Technologies
Ethereum, the established pioneer, introduced the world to programmable blockchain agreements. Its robust ecosystem is built on a Proof-of-Work (PoW) consensus mechanism, though it is gradually transitioning to Proof-of-Stake (PoS) with its Ethereum 2.0 upgrades. This vast network effect comes with significant advantages in developer tools and community size.
Cardano entered the scene later, branding itself as a third-generation blockchain. It was built from the ground up using a scientific philosophy and peer-reviewed research. It utilizes a unique Proof-of-Stake consensus mechanism called Ouroboros, which is designed to be more energy-efficient and scalable from its inception.
The Critical Issue of Transaction Costs
One of the most immediate and practical differences between these two networks is the cost to use them, commonly referred to as "gas fees."
Ethereum's Gas Fee Challenge
On the Ethereum network, every operation—from a simple token transfer to deploying a complex smart contract—requires computational resources. Users pay for these resources with "gas," denominated in Gwei (a fraction of ETH). The price of gas is not fixed; it fluctuates based on network demand, leading to periods of extreme congestion and exorbitant fees.
The base cost to create a simple operation is 3,200 gas. An additional 2,100 gas is required to enter a new transaction into a block, bringing the creation price to 5,300 gas. To put this into a real-world cost:
- 5,300 Gas 0.0000001 Ether per Gas $4,000 per Ether = $21.20
This is just the starting point for deploying an empty contract. Real-world applications are collections of multiple contracts interacting, each incurring its own deployment fee.
Furthermore, storing data on-chain is exceptionally costly on Ethereum, priced at 20,000 gas per 256 bits. Storing a single kilobyte of data costs approximately 640,000 gas, or over $250 at the same ETH price. A moderately sized 8,000 KB contract could easily incur over $2,100 in storage costs alone during deployment.
These compounding costs mean deploying even a moderate-sized smart contract on Ethereum can require a budget upwards of $5,000, making it prohibitively expensive for many developers and small projects.
Cardano's Predictable and Low-Cost Model
Cardano's fee structure is fundamentally different and designed for predictability. The cost to deploy a smart contract involves two main components:
- A minimal fee to lock the contract amount (as little as $0.01 worth of ADA).
- A predictable transaction fee, which is typically less than $0.35.
This model ensures that the total cost to deploy a full smart contract often remains under $0.36. Crucially, even if the price of ADA increases significantly, the transaction fee formula keeps costs low and predictable, rarely exceeding $30 even in extreme market conditions. This makes financial planning for project deployment far more stable.
👉 Discover the current network fees for smart contracts
Performance and Transaction Speed
Speed is a critical factor for user experience and application scalability.
Ethereum's current mainnet handles about 15-30 transactions per second (TPS). During periods of high demand, this limited throughput creates a bottleneck, causing transactions to be delayed until users bid a high enough gas fee to be included in a block. This results in slow and unreliable processing times.
Cardano's Ouroboros protocol is designed for higher throughput. While exact numbers evolve with each upgrade, its theoretical capability is over 250 TPS, and its layered architecture separates settlement from computation, paving the way for even greater future scalability. This translates to transactions that are not only cheaper but also finalized much faster.
The NFT Experience: Minting and Trading
NFTs have become a primary use case for smart contracts, highlighting the cost and efficiency differences between the two chains.
Minting NFTs on Ethereum is a costly endeavor. The process of deploying the smart contract and then minting each individual token involves complex computations and storage, often pushing total costs into the hundreds of dollars per project. For artists and creators, this high barrier to entry can be discouraging.
Minting NFTs on Cardano follows its low-cost principle. There is no direct "minting fee," but a minimum of approximately 1.5 ADA must be locked in the contract that mints the token. At current prices, this brings the total cost for minting an NFT project to well under $2. This low cost democratizes creation, allowing more artists to participate in the NFT ecosystem.
Frequently Asked Questions
Which is more decentralized, Ethereum or Cardano?
Both networks are highly decentralized. Ethereum's decentralization comes from its massive, global miner and node operator network. Cardano achieves decentralization through its globally distributed stake pool operators, where anyone holding ADA can participate in the consensus process. The "better" model is a subject of ongoing philosophical debate within the crypto community.
Is Cardano more secure than Ethereum?
Both platforms are considered highly secure but have different security models. Ethereum's security is proven by its long history and immense hashing power. Cardano's security is rooted in its peer-reviewed, formal method approach to development, which aims to mathematically verify code and reduce vulnerabilities before they are deployed.
Can Ethereum 2.0 solve its gas fee problems?
The full rollout of Ethereum 2.0, with its shift to Proof-of-Stake and implementation of shard chains, is explicitly designed to address scalability and high fees. The success and timeline of this transition are key factors in Ethereum's ability to remain competitive against newer, lower-cost chains like Cardano.
Which platform has a larger developer ecosystem?
Ethereum currently has a much larger and more mature developer ecosystem, with more tools, documentation, and existing dApps. However, Cardano's ecosystem is growing rapidly as its smart contract capabilities expand, attracting developers interested in its rigorous scientific approach and lower costs.
Should I build my dApp on Ethereum or Cardano?
The choice depends on your project's needs. If you require the deepest liquidity, largest user base, and most established tooling today, Ethereum may be the answer, albeit at a high cost. If low transaction costs, predictable fees, and a scientifically-built platform are your priorities, Cardano presents a compelling alternative.
Are my assets on either chain safe?
The underlying blockchain technology for both Ethereum and Cardano is secure. However, asset safety ultimately depends on user practices: using reputable wallets, safeguarding private keys, and interacting with audited smart contracts. The chains themselves provide the secure foundation.
Final Verdict: Choosing the Right Platform
The competition between Ethereum and Cardano isn't about one being universally "better" than the other. It's about choosing the right tool for the job.
Ethereum remains the industry behemoth. Its first-mover advantage has created an unparalleled network effect, liquidity, and ecosystem. For large-scale projects that can absorb high gas fees and need immediate access to the largest DeFi and NFT markets, Ethereum is the incumbent leader.
Cardano positions itself as the sustainable and scalable successor. Its methodical, research-driven development has resulted in a platform with negligible fees, faster transactions, and a strong foundation for future growth. For developers, creators, and users prioritizing low costs, energy efficiency, and long-term scalability, Cardano presents a powerful and arguably superior alternative.
👉 Explore advanced strategies for blockchain development
The blockchain space is evolving rapidly. While Ethereum is working to upgrade its foundation, Cardano is building its ecosystem from the ground up. For NFTs and smart contracts, your best choice hinges on whether you value the established ecosystem of Ethereum or the cost-effective and scalable promise of Cardano.